The news is often littered with stories about stars auctioning off personal items, typically guitars, sheet music or clothing on famous tours. Now we hear that Sir Rod Stewart intends to auction off furniture, yes, his furniture. On September 11th, Rod will hold a special auction that allows fans to bid on household items like a teak armchair, bronze side tables, picture frames and more.

The event will be handled by Sworders’ Fine Art of Stansted Mountfitchet, Essex, with 60+ items will be up for bid from his Essex UK mansion, including 19th-century mirrors and bronze wall sconces, figurines and other pieces of rare and collectible furniture.

We’re not sure what Rod will do with the extra money or why he’s choosing to downsize his room at the mansion, but we’ll keep you posted on the auction and final tally, held September 11th in Essex UK.
